Transaction 7439a62e070d1af195966875e5fd5cf88523dab963e8387a9423a65c50ed2550
1 Input
2 Outputs
- 7439a62e070d1af195966875e5fd5cf88523dab963e8387a9423a65c50ed2550:0
- 7439a62e070d1af195966875e5fd5cf88523dab963e8387a9423a65c50ed2550:1
value 874780
address 1FTScrtgUdQ7r67TYdyDVKiHgnoMR7FQ5K
value 50000000
address 3PPRycZgE79piHhxiNWpnXWxZ6HzTNiK7i